Forums

Home » Liferay Portal » Português

Combination View Flat View Tree View
Threads [ Previous | Next ]
toggle
Renato Rodrigues de Araujo
Abrir conteúdo web em outra página com publicador de ativo.
May 22, 2012 11:55 AM
Answer

Renato Rodrigues de Araujo

Rank: New Member

Posts: 4

Join Date: July 17, 2011

Recent Posts

Bom, passei um tempo procurando alguma solução para esse meu problema mas não consegui de forma nenhuma fazer funcionar.

Eu tenho a página de notícias com um publicador de ativo e a home com outro publicador fazendo referência as mesmas notícias.
Quando eu estou na home e clico em uma notícia, ela abre dentro desta mesma página de forma maximizada, e gostaria de abrir essa notícia (conteúdo web) dentro do publicador de ativo da página de notícias.

Estive tentando fazer algo da seguinte forma, porém sem sucesso algum (rs):

1
2viewURL = viewURL.replaceAll("ID_PORTLET","ID_PUBLICADOR");


Qualquer ajuda agradeço.
Gustavo Perdigão Cardoso
RE: Abrir conteúdo web em outra página com publicador de ativo.
May 22, 2012 2:31 PM
Answer

Gustavo Perdigão Cardoso

Rank: Junior Member

Posts: 58

Join Date: March 24, 2009

Recent Posts

E aí Renato, tudo bem?

Qual a versão do seu Liferay?
Renato Rodrigues de Araujo
RE: Abrir conteúdo web em outra página com publicador de ativo.
May 22, 2012 5:18 PM
Answer

Renato Rodrigues de Araujo

Rank: New Member

Posts: 4

Join Date: July 17, 2011

Recent Posts

Opa Gustavo, tudo beleza!

Cara, eu to usando o 6.0.6 CE.
Gustavo Perdigão Cardoso
RE: Abrir conteúdo web em outra página com publicador de ativo.
May 24, 2012 7:25 AM
Answer

Gustavo Perdigão Cardoso

Rank: Junior Member

Posts: 58

Join Date: March 24, 2009

Recent Posts

Bom dia Renato, tudo bem?
Bom, eu também tive problemas parecidos quando utilizava a mesma versão que você utiliza hoje. No meu caso eu resolvia com javascript. Era meio que uma "gambiarra" mesmo, devido à minha falta de conhecimento na época. Primeiro eu associava o meu asset-publisher à minha página de apresentação em: "configurações>>aparencia>>Associar URL do portlet à página" . Depois, minha página de apresentação eu colocava outro asset-publisher, e por fim o meu javascript apenas trocava, no link para a notícia, os ids dos portlets. Essa solução me atendeu bem durante algum tempo. Entretanto, acho que não seria melhor. Já leu sobre " Hooks? Acho que pode solucionar seu problema.

Abaixo seguem uma url que pode te ajudar:

http://docs.liferay.com/portal/6.0/official/liferay-developer-guide-6.0.pdf (
http://www.liferay.com/community/wiki/-/wiki/Proposals/Linking+to+web+content+on+another+page



Na versão 6.1 , todo esse processo acima ficou bastante simples, sugiro que faça a atualização.

Boa sorte!
Mislene Silva
RE: Abrir conteúdo web em outra página com publicador de ativo.
October 16, 2012 7:19 AM
Answer

Mislene Silva

Rank: New Member

Posts: 21

Join Date: April 20, 2012

Recent Posts

Olá eu fiz com publicador de conteúdo, porém estou tendo um problema não consigo redirecionar o link leia mais para abrir em outra página, gostaria que ele redireciona-se para outro link, por favor se alguém souber me ajude.

Obrigada